The grading scale for our school district is as follows:

A 100 – 94%
B 93 – 86%
C 85 – 76%
D 75 – 70%
F 69 – 0%

Why Homework is Assigned: The main goal of any homework assignment is to reinforce the academic skills being taught in class.  Students should never feel overwhelmed with homework assignments due to the amount of in-class time they will have available to work on them.  Students learn responsibility by completing homework assignments and submitting them when they are due.

When I Assign Homework: Homework is assigned each day of the week.  Students will be expected to read for twenty minutes for five days of the week.  I will give plenty of notice for students to prepare for tests.

Late Work/Incomplete Work: If a student does not submit an assignment on time, he/she will receive a homework notice that will need to be signed by a parent and returned with the homework assignment the following day.  If the assignment is not returned the following day with the homework notice, the student will receive a red notice with a lunch detention.  The first day an assignment is late 10 percentage points will be deducted from the final grade.  If an assignment is more than one day late, 20 percentage points will be deducted from the final grade.  All assignments will be completed no matter how many days they are late.

Absences: Students are responsible for making up all assigned work on days that they are absent from class.  When students return to school they will be given all of the work they missed unless a parent has already picked it up.  Students will have the same number of days that they were absent to complete the work.  Assignments should be turned in as soon as possible.  Regular attendance is strongly encouraged.  It is often difficult for students to catch up if they are frequently absent as much of our work is done in class.
